What Is a Halbach Array Permanent Magnet?
A Halbach array permanent magnet is a specific arrangement of permanent magnets that creates a strong magnetic field on one side while significantly reducing it on the opposite side. This directional enhancement is achieved through a clever alignment of magnetization vectors, allowing for precise magnetic control without the need for additional iron components.
Originally conceptualized by physicist Klaus Halbach for particle accelerator systems, this magnetic array has since become a preferred solution in applications requiring compact and efficient magnetic field generation.
Magnetic Field Enhancement Principle
The working principle behind the Halbach array permanent magnet lies in the rotating direction of magnetization within the array. By rotating the magnetic orientation of each block magnet—typically in 90° or 45° increments—the magnetic fields align constructively on one side and destructively on the other.
This arrangement results in a one-sided magnetic flux, where the magnetic field is intensified on the working face while almost nullified on the reverse. The result is greater efficiency, minimal leakage, and optimal use of magnetic energy—particularly beneficial for motors, sensors, and maglev applications.
Types of Halbach Array Configurations
Halbach array permanent magnets can be arranged in various configurations, depending on the application:
-
Linear Halbach Arrays – A straight-line sequence of magnets with rotating magnetization. Commonly used in magnetic conveyors, maglev tracks, and linear actuators.
-
Circular (or Cylindrical) Halbach Arrays – Magnets arranged in a ring with their polarities rotating around the center. Ideal for high-efficiency electric motors, flywheels, and contactless bearings.
These configurations rely on accurate orientation and spacing to ensure optimal magnetic performance, making manufacturing precision a critical factor.
